How Our Team Handles Burst Pipe Water Removal in Navasota, TX
The process of removing water from a burst pipe is more complex than you might think. It needs specialized equipment and a team of trained technicians who know how to handle the situation with care. Our team uses a combination of pumps, vacuums, and drying equipment to extract the water and dry out the affected area. We work efficiently to reduce the disruption to your daily life, but we never compromise on quality or safety.
Step 1: Emergency Response
Our team will arrive within 60 minutes of your call to assess the situation and begin the water removal process. We’ll use our specialized equipment to extract the water and prevent further dam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use a combination of pumps and vacuums to extract as much water as possible from the affected area.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old and mildew grow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use specialized drying equipment to dry out the affected area. This includes using desiccants, dehumidifiers, and air movers to remove excess moisture and prevent further damage.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
We’ll use specialized cleaning solutions to sanitize and disinfect the affected area. This is a critical step in preventing the growth of mold and mildew, and ensuring that your property is safe to occupy.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Once the affected area has been dried and sanitized, we’ll begin the restoration and reconstruction process. This includes repairing or replacing damaged materials, and ensuring that your property is safe and secure.

Burst Pipe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ak, contained to a single room | Yes | No | You can likely handle the situation yourself with a wet/dry vacuum and some towels. |
| Large leak, affecting multiple rooms or floors | No | Yes | The situation is too complex and needs spec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ely and effectively. |
| Standing water, up to 2 inches deep | No | Yes | The water is too deep and needs specialized equipment to extract safely and efficiently. |
| Musty odors, warping or buckling flooring | No | Yes | The situation is more complex and needs specialized expertise to identify and address the underlying issue. |
